In a significant development in the legal troubles facing former President Donald Trump, his former lawyer Michael Cohen has provided crucial inside information in a trial related to hush money payments made to women who allegedly had affairs with Trump. Cohen, who was sentenced to three years in prison in 2018 for crimes including campaign finance violations and lying to Congress, has emerged as a key witness in the case. The trial revolves around payments made to adult film actress Stormy Daniels and former Playboy model Karen McDougal to keep quiet about their relationships with Trump during his presidential campaign.

Cohen’s testimony has shed light on the extent to which Trump was involved in the payments and the efforts to conceal them from the public. Cohen has revealed details of conversations he had with Trump and others involved in the scheme, implicating the former president in potential violations of campaign finance laws.
